vindictive

adj.
1.disposed to seek revenge or intended for revenge
2.showing malicious ill will and a desire to hurt

  • Idiom of the Day

    take (someone) for a ride
    to play a trick on or fool someone, to take unfair advantage of someone
    The used car salesman took me for a ride. The car that I bought is not very good.
